What Repairs Should I Make Before Selling My Home?

by Gordon Hageman

Twitter Facebook Linkedin
From experience, I recommend focusing on the high-impact repairs that buyers notice first. Fix anything safety-related — electrical, plumbing, or structural issues — as these can scare off offers or complicate inspections. Then, look at cosmetic updates that modernize the feel: fresh interior paint, new cabinet hardware, and lighting upgrades. Address signs of wear like cracked caulking, chipped tiles, or stained carpets. Buyers tend to overestimate repair costs, so presenting a well-maintained home gives them confidence and often leads to stronger offers.
